Detalles del Curso

โ€ข Fundamentals of Piezoelectricity: Understanding the basics of piezoelectricity, its principles, and history.
โ€ข Piezoelectric Materials: Types and classes of piezoelectric materials, including ceramics, polymers, and crystals.
โ€ข Properties and Characterization Techniques: Exploring the properties of piezoelectric materials and the techniques used to characterize them, such as dielectric constant measurement and piezoelectric coefficient determination.
โ€ข Fabrication Techniques: Overview of various fabrication techniques for piezoelectric materials, including sintering, poling, and deposition.
โ€ข Piezoelectric Sensors and Transducers: Introduction to the use of piezoelectric materials in sensors and transducers, including applications and design considerations.
โ€ข Piezoelectric Actuators: Examination of the use of piezoelectric materials in actuators, including design, modeling, and applications.
โ€ข Data Analysis Techniques: Techniques for analyzing data obtained from characterization of piezoelectric materials, including statistical analysis and data interpretation.
โ€ข Safety and Environmental Considerations: Overview of safety and environmental considerations when working with piezoelectric materials, including disposal and handling procedures.
โ€ข Ethics in Materials Science: Introduction to ethical considerations in materials science, including responsible conduct of research and ethical considerations in the use of materials.
